Unlike the Christmas Holiday Weekend which saw recording breaking cold and wind chill readings, the New Year’s Weekend looks to be much warmer.
National Weather Service Forecasters say after a warm day today, a cold front will cool things down back into the 50’s for highs on Friday but then get right back into the 60’s for both New Year’s Eve Saturday and New Year’s Day on Sunday. After several days of windy conditions, winds will die down after today for most of the weekend.
A chance of rain is in the forecast for tonight and earlier Friday with a better chance of rain in the forecast for Monday.
